Chief Executive Officer
Hillcrest Family Services
For more than 125 years, Hillcrest Family Services has been a trusted provider of behavioral health and human services across Eastern Iowa. Today, the organization delivers more than 20 services spanning outpatient mental health, residential treatment, community-based adult services, crisis stabilization, and addictions recovery. Hillcrest partners with hospitals, schools, public safety agencies, and community organizations to provide accessible, mission-driven care throughout the region.
